RI Interscholastic Athletic
Administrators’ Association Announces 2016 Award Recipients
Athletic Director of the Year
Chris Cobain became the Director of Athletics/Assistant Principal for East Greenwich Public Schools on October 5th 2009. He currently serves as the President Elect for the RI Interscholastic Athletic Administrators’ Association and serves as the Awards Committee Chair. He has been an RIIAAA Executive Board Member since 2012. He serves as a State Delegate for Rhode Island as part of the Section 1 at the National Interscholastic Athletic Administrators Association meetings. Chris serves on several RI Interscholastic League Sport Committees including Boys Basketball, Boys & Girls Volleyball, Golf and Field Hockey. Chris also continues his progress towards Certification as a Certified Athletic Administrator (CAA) through his participation in Leadership Training Course work on the state and national level. He has attended NIAAA Conferences in Nashville (2016) and Orlando (2015) as well as many Massachusetts/Rhode Island IAAA Conferences in Hyannis, MA.
Prior to his position at EGHS, Chris has held the following positions over his 18 year educational career.
Exeter West Greenwich HS Business Educator: 1998 to 2005
Exeter West Greenwich HS Assistant Principal : 2005 to 2007
EWG Varsity Boys Basketball Coach: 2001 to 2008 (Executive Board: 2002 to 2008)
Lincoln Middle School Assistant Principal: 2007 to 2009
Some accomplishments that have occurred during his tenure include East Greenwich High School being named the RIIAAA School of the year in 2013 and 2016. Other noteworthy accomplishments include: EGHS becoming a pilot school for unified sports in Rhode Island, winning Unified Volleyball National Championships in both 2012 and 2013, and having Rhode Island’s, first Wendy’s Heisman National Male Athlete of the Year.
In addition, to these personal and school accolades, Chris takes great pride in the success of EGHS individual athletes, coaches and programs during his tenure. Some of those accomplishments include:
● Rhode Island Gatorade Baseball Player of the year 2011
● Rhode Island Gatorade Football Player of the year 2015
● 26 State and National Championships
● Many 1st and 2nd team All-state Athletes
● Coaches who have won state and/or national Coach of the Year recognition
● Close to 70% student athlete participation at EGHS
East Greenwich High School has graduated several athletes to Colleges or Universities at all 3 levels of the NCAA, some of which have received athletic scholarships to continue their career.
